Transaction 76516af26af91c7536418c83ebb4cec44ec008230eb68f8d631e3c41b03723f6

1 Input
2 Outputs
  • 76516af26af91c7536418c83ebb4cec44ec008230eb68f8d631e3c41b03723f6:0
  • value  573811
    address  3QNRe8PBtKkAN4psqeZWaF2XCYHgoUywAt
  • 76516af26af91c7536418c83ebb4cec44ec008230eb68f8d631e3c41b03723f6:1
  • value  5359103
    address  bc1qucqda885kpdnzddh3qram7vhhnpqe7alxa2u8w